Types of Bunk Beds
When considering a bunk bed sale, it's crucial to understand the various designs offered on the marketplace. Below are the most common types:

Traditional Bunk Beds: These consist of 2 beds stacked one above the other, sharing a single frame. They are often the most economical alternative.

L-Shaped Bunk Beds: This design includes one bed placed vertically and another horizontally. This arrangement develops extra space underneath the upper bed, which can be used for storage or a play location.

Lofted Beds: Similar to traditional bunk beds however without any lower bed. Instead, the space below can be utilized for a desk, play location, or additional storage.

Triple Bunk Beds: For families with a larger variety of children or regular slumber parties, triple bunk beds supply three sleeping locations in a space-efficient design.

Futon Bunk Beds: These styles combine bunk beds and futon sofas. The bottom area converts into a separate seating location, improving performance.

Convertible Bunk Beds: These beds can be separated into two specific beds, making them versatile as kids's needs change in time.
